By Felipe V Celino
ROXAS CITY, Capiz – Police served a warrant of arrest for illegal drug trade to an inmate of the Pontevedra Municipal Police Station Thursday afternoon.
Sulpicio Devera, 51, of Panitan town received the warrant inside the jail.
Devera was arrested last month in a separate drug buy-bust operation conducted by Pontevedra Municipal Police Station in Barangay Tacas, Pontevedra, Capiz.
Last week, Devera was charged anew for violation of Republic Act 9165 or Comprehensive Dangerous Drugs Act of 2002 after the seizure of 6 sachets of suspected shabu weighing 25 grams valued at P170,000, P3,500 marked money, a motorcycle, and several drug paraphernalia.
He is also facing charges for violation of Republic Act 9516 or Illegal Possession of Explosives after a caliber. 45 caliber was recovered from him.
The warrant of arrest was issued by Regional Trial Court Judge Kristine B. Tiangco-Vinculado of Branch 16 on August 9, 2023.
No bail was recommended for his temporary liberty.
He is presently in the custody of Pontevedra Municipal Police Station.
